God Of War TV Series Announces Callum Vinson Is Set To Play Atreus

Callum Vinson has been cast as Atreus in Amazon Prime’s upcoming God of War series, Sony Pictures and Amazon MGM Studios have announced today.
The actor has recently garnered a lot of attention for his upcoming role as the young Jason Voorhees in Crystal Lake, the prequel to Friday the 13th, and is set to feature in the third season of The Night Agent on Netflix. He previously appeared in Long Bright River alongside Amanda Seyfried, Chucky, and is the voice behind Piglet in Disney Jr.’s Playdate with Winnie the Pooh.
Atreus, as fans of the God of War video games will recall, is the son of Kratos. Growing up with his father in a remote forest cabin and isolated from the rest of the world, Atreus is an accomplish archer, and has a love for animals and is eager to see what lies beyond the confine of his home. He accompanies Kratos on a journey to scatter his mother’s ashes, bringing him into contact with the dangers and wonders of the Norse world.
The God of War series has unveiled a number of key castings in recent weeks, including Ryan Hurst (Kratos), Max Parker (Heimdall), Ólafur Darri Ólafsson & Mandy Patinkin (Thor & Odin), and Alastair Duncan (Mimir).
God of War is set to begin production in Vancouver, Canada next month and will feature Ronald D. Moore as showrunner, executive producer, and writer.
